Blanching is defined as the enzyme (heat resistant) deactivation phenomena, which helps in retaining color, reduction in initial microbial growth, cleansing the product, product preheating prior to processing, and gas exhausting from plant tissue (Shaheen, El-Massry, El-Ghorab, & Anjum, 2012), and helps to release carotenoids, thus enhancing …

WebNov 23, 2024 · What Is Blanching? Blanching vegetables involves cooking them quickly in generously salted, boiling water to draw out their vibrant flavors and colors. The dull color you often see in raw green vegetables occurs because of the layer of gas that exists between the pigment and the skin. WebMar 22, 2024 · Blanching the Carrots Download Article 1 Prepare a bowl of ice water. You'll need this to stop the carrots from cooking after you boil them. 2 Heat a saucepan of water. Use a saucepan large enough to hold the carrots, and fill it about 3/4 the way full. Heat the water on the stove top on the highest heat. Season the water to taste by adding salt.

When skin is blanched, it takes on a whitish appearance as blood flow to the region is prevented.
